Output 75618959d88ba1214bf7b495533d81a4e684ad384f8c82e47020e2bd649b9648:0

value
1343341
script pubkey
OP_0 OP_PUSHBYTES_20 ef530070361642c80a249e56201bdee7cb7a0f3c
address
bc1qaafsqupkzepvsz3ynetzqx77ul9h5reujsaqhj
transaction
75618959d88ba1214bf7b495533d81a4e684ad384f8c82e47020e2bd649b9648